SHRIMP IN CITRUSY CHEESE SAUCE, MASHED POTATOES
Prep Time 20 mins | Cook Time 25 mins | Servings 2
INGREDIENTS
- 1/3 Lb Large Shrimp (raw, deveined)
- 4 Oz Mascarpone Cheese
- 4 Oz Heavy shipping cream
- 6 Med Yellow potatoes (cut in quarters)
- 1 Tbsp Olive oil
- 2½ Serving Citrusy-Dill SpiceBean ™
- 1 Tbsp Butter
- ½ Tsp Salt
SUPPLIES
•Medium pot ▪ (2) Medium bowls
•Spatula, Large Fork ▪ Potato peeler
•Medium skillet ▪ Cutting board, Knife, Plate
HOW TO COOK
SHRIMP, SAUCE
•Drain shrimp. Salt with ¼ Tsp salt. Toss and let stand for 2 minutes
•In skillet heat olive oil.
•Add Shrimp brown for 2 minutes. Flip and repeat for 1 minute
•Remove to bowl
•In same skillet add 2 oz whipping cream. When sizzling add cheese, Stir continuously
•Add (1½) servings of SpiceBean ™ , mix well to blend with sauce
•Add shrimp with (aujus) juice. Stir a few times.
•Remove from heat and return to bowl.
POTATOES
•Bring 6 cups of water to boil in pot
•Add potatoes and continue to boil about 20 minutes (until fork pierce)
•Remove to bowl.
• Heat (1) serving of SpiceBean ™ in pot until soften
•Return potatoes to pot mixing well and smashing potatoes with fork
•Remove from heat
•Add butter and (1/4 Tsp) salt. (salt to taste). Fork whip well.
•Slowly add (2 oz) whipping cream. Fork whip.
READY TO SERVE
